No matter what occasion or location, no one likes to have a bad hair day. It can mean a whole lot of unrelated things go wrong. Luckily, we've discovered a hairstyle that will ensure you have a great hair day, even if your strands are a little dirty. You know, the day between washes when your hair is looking a touch greasy and smells a little gross? Well, this style is perfect for it. And it's super easy. Keep reading to discover how to recreate it!
First, spritz your hair with a dry shampoo, we like Klorane Dry Shampoo with Oat Milk, or for girls with fine hair, try Oribé's Côte d'Azur Hair Refresher, as it doesn't weigh down light locks and smells delicious.
Then, pick up a simple black Alice band (or even a piece of black ribbon!), slip it on your head (you can part your hair in the center or pull it straight back) and then pull your remaining locks into a bun, ponytail, or, just like this look (which is from Valentino's A/W 2013 show), a braid. And voila! The top of your head, which is likely to look the greasiest, is hidden from sight, and you've got a style that works just as well in a corporate office as it does at the playground.
